Those spectacular sights of the aurora borealis this year were a precursor of hazardous electro-magnetic pulses (EMPs) from solar tornados. EMPs can damage digital systems and overload power grids, creating power outages. They aren’t simply produced by solar task; human attackers might likewise produce EMPs, for instance by detonating a nuclear tool high in the ambience. The good news is, scientists like Yilu Liu, that goes to Oak Ridge National Lab in Tennessee, are dealing with the issue. In a Q&A with IEEE SpectrumIEEE Spectrum, she describes the risks of EMPs and just how her laboratory is dealing with creating structures that shield delicate devices inside.
In remote or hard to reach places, where a wind generator simply isn’t practical, there is a new option for renewable energy generation: Kites. Kitepower, based in the Netherlands, is functioning to apply an electricity-generating kite system, called theHawk As the wind draws on their kites’ ground secure, it produces a pressure that is exchanged electric power. The 60-square-meter kites can fly as high as 350 meters (over two times the elevation of a wind generator) to capture more powerful and steadier winds. The kites include a 400-kilowatt-hour battery, and the whole system matches a common delivery container. Kitepower intends to send out the Hawk to remote neighborhoods that presently count on diesel generators, supplying them with a cleaner resource of power that occupies a lot less room than a wind generator.
Historically, heat pumps have actually battled to operate in the chilly, with the majority of operating at a decreased capability around 4 ° C, and falling short at concerning -15 ° C. Now, with renovations in their compressors, heat-pump suppliers state they have the innovation to heat homes just as efficiently in bitter cold as they carry out in milder winter season temperature levels. Heatpump work by relocating and pressing liquids that have an extremely reduced boiling factor. The compressor is the aspect that enhances the fluid-turned-vapors’ temperature level and stress, so renovations in the compressor’s electric motor rate and timing of infusing even more vapor have actually made heatpump extra effective in chillier temperature levels. The United State Division of Power in collaboration with Natural Resources Canada is organizing the Cold-Climate Heat Pump Technology Challenge, where 8 stack pump suppliers are evaluating their heatpump, with an objective of doing at optimal capability– also at -15 ° C.
Smart agriculture IoT tools aid farmers comprehend the huge photo concept of what is taking place around their land by determining general practitioner works with, wetness degrees, temperature levels, level of acidity, nutrients, and extra. The issue is providing sufficient power to those spread sensing units. However suppose we made use of something that currently links every one of the tools? That’s right–the soil Scientists at Tennessee Technological University made an approach of transferring power with the ground. The scientists’ 2-acre examination network sent power at 60 hertz, using up just 0.1 kilowatt-hour daily. If they had actually paid retail prices for that power, it would certainly have cost them simply over a cent a day.
Ebb Carbon is a California-based start-up positioned to begin getting rid of numerous tonnes of co2 from the air. Their carbon dioxide removal plant in Port Angeles, Washington, called Project Macoma, will certainly make use of an electrochemical procedure to divide salt water right into acidic and fundamental sections. The acidic stream will certainly be reduced the effects of or shipped, and the fundamental stream will certainly be launched right into the sea. There, it will certainly blend with co2 to develop bicarbonate, a secure method to keep carbon. As the task records and shops carbon monoxide 2 from the sea, the sea would certainly have the ability to attract even more carbon monoxide 2 from the air. Although several sea researchers are hesitant of aquatic geoengineering jobs similar to this one, The united state Division of Power has actually created a United States $100 million Carbon Shot program that will certainly money co2 elimination and storage space, consisting of in sea tanks.
Millions of tonnes of photovoltaic panels will certainly get to completion of their lives in 2025. They include silicon, silver, and copper– products that are extremely important yet tough to draw out from the equipment. The very best present procedures for solar panel recycling can recuperate 90 percent of these steels, yet they are costly and typically make use of hazardous chemicals. Start-up 9-Tech has a reusing procedure that recovers up to 90 percent of the products without making use of hazardous chemicals or launching toxins right into the atmosphere. Employees at 9-Tech’s pilot manufacturing facility by hand eliminate the light weight aluminum structure, joint box, and toughened up glass from the photovoltaic panels. After that the staying products are fed right into a heater at 400 ° C, and arising toxins are recorded with a filter. A collection of filters divides the glass and silicon, after that the silicon is sent out to an acid bathroom where ultrasonic waves divided it from its connected silver. The procedure is costly, yet the products recuperated are top quality, which ought to aid to counter the price, claims the start-up creators.
If we wish to totally decarbonize the aeronautics market, we’re mosting likely to need to believe beyond package. Ian McKay provides a feasible future where we make use of stadium-sized microwave arrays to beam up power to antennae on aircrafts. These microwaves might travel through clouds and not damage guests, though they would certainly warm up the air significantly, perhaps harmful neighboring birds. Though absolutely nothing similar to this has actually ever before been tried, technical renovations recommend this might be feasible, consisting of a CalTech start-up that means to make use of phased ranges tobeam solar power from satellites to Earth Despite having massive technical obstacles and feasible governing concerns, this assumed experiment deserves taking into consideration, since less-fanciful alternatives for decarbonizing aeronautics have their own problems.
Climeworks, a Zurich-based business, claims its brand-new direct-air capture (DAC) innovation will certainly eliminate countless tonnes of co2 by the end of the years. Their latest facility will at some point draw 36,000 tonnes of carbon monoxide 2 out of the air yearly. Their new DAC technology relies upon a brand-new sorbent (the product that takes in carbon monoxide 2) with a geometry that has actually been customized to subject even more area to the air, catching two times as much carbon monoxide 2 The brand-new layout will certainly change their collection agency devices’ framework from three-tiered shelfs to a cube-like layout, with 4 wall surfaces of collection agencies bordering a main shaft. These will certainly be made use of in the Project Cypress DAC Hub, a task moneyed by the united state Division of Power to develop the initial one-million-tonne co2 elimination center in the USA.
Solar panels are constructed to last. In order to stand up to extreme climate, transforming temperature levels, and the damage of years of usage, they require a limited seal on their photovoltaic products. The majority of suppliers develop this seal by including sticky polymer layers in between the glass panes. However these polymers come to be exceptionally challenging to eliminate at the end of a photovoltaic panel’s life. Scientists at the United State National Renewable Energy Lab have actually located a method to fuse the glass without a polymer, melting it together with femtosecondlasers This extreme beam of light of photons alters the optical absorption of the glass, creating a little plasma of ionized glass atoms which thaw the glass sheets with each other. This brand-new technique produces photovoltaic panels that last longer and are simpler to reuse.
Data centers are power drinkers, specifically in warmer environments. However scientists in Singapore are currently evaluating meansto cool them sustainably A partnership of over 20 technology business, colleges, and federal government companies are interacting on theSustainable Tropical Data Centre Testbed They are evaluating a brand-new StatePoint Liquid Cooling system, where a hydrophobic microporous membrane layer produces a liquid-to-air warm exchanger that cools water. This system is extra reliable in warm and damp atmospheres as it creates chilly water rather than chilly air. The scientists will certainly likewise check a model desiccant-coated heat and mass exchanger, covered in a desiccant product that takes in water vapor from the air overlooking it, drying the air to evaporate the information facility. In the future, they want to bring these energy-saving modern technologies to exotic information facilities around the world.
